1.

This matter is taken up through hybrid mode.

2.

Heard learned counsel for the Petitioner and learned counsel for the State.

3.

The Petitioner is an accused in G.R. Case No.1068 of 2022 pending on the file of learned S.D.J.M., Angul, arising out of Angul Town P.S. Case No.395 of 2022, for commission of offence under Sections 420/120-B IPC.

4.

Being aggrieved by the rejection of his application for bail U/s. 439 Cr.P.C by the learned Addl. Sessions Judge, Angul by order dated 29.09.2022 in the aforementioned case, the present BLAPL has been filed.

5.

It is submitted by the learned counsel for the Petitioner that the Petitioner is in custody since 23.07.2022 and as charge sheet has been filed on 06.09.2022, his further continuance in custody is not warranted.

6.

Learned counsel for the State opposes the prayer for bail. 7.

It is apt to note that during pendency of the bail application, the Petitioner without prejudice to his rights has paid an amount of Rs.7 lakhs to the Informant. An affidavit evidencing the same is taken on record.

8.

Taking into account the payment as made without prejudice to the rights of the Petitioner-accused, this Court directs the Petitioner to be released on bail on such terms to be fixed by the learned court in seisin over the matter.

9.

Accordingly, the BLAPL stands disposed of.
